Massey Lake trail ride set Saturday

The Massey Lake Trail Blazers Annual Ride will begin on Friday with a fish fry. The ride will begin at 2 p.m. on Saturday at a new location, Wilsons Property on the corner of CR 2802 (second turn) and FM 2054 at Massey Lake in Tennessee Colony. The admission is $5 per person at the gate (children 12 years of age and under are free).

The trail will work whether you are riding or driving a buggy or wagon, a news release said. Four wheelers are welcome, but remember the horses have the right of way. Space is available to camp out if there is a need. Friday evening is the fish fry and will go on while the fish lasts. On Saturday, there will be food and drink available for a reasonable fee. Water is available for the horses. There will be a deejay on both days.

A current Coggins test is needed for the horses. The event will not be responsible for any accidents, a news release said.
